Road Safety in Korea

South Korea has made significant efforts to improve road safety in recent years. The government has implemented strict traffic laws and regulations, increased penalties for traffic violations, and launched public awareness campaigns to educate drivers and pedestrians on safe road practices.

Despite these efforts, road safety remains a major concern in Korea. The country has one of the highest rates of road traffic accidents in the world, with a large number of fatalities and injuries reported each year. Factors such as speeding, drunk driving, and distracted driving contribute to the high accident rate.

To address these issues, the Korean government continues to invest in infrastructure improvements, such as expanding road networks and installing traffic lights and speed cameras. In addition, the police regularly conduct crackdowns on traffic violations to enforce road safety laws and reduce accidents.

Overall, while progress has been made in improving road safety in Korea, there is still work to be done to further reduce the number of accidents and fatalities on the country’s roads. Continued efforts in enforcement, education, and infrastructure development are key to creating safer roads for all road users.
